What the Washer Fluid Level Light Means on a Skoda Kamiq
The washer fluid light on a Skoda Kamiq simply means the windscreen washer reservoir is low. It is purely informational — top up the fluid and it clears.

What Causes the Washer Fluid Level Light to Come On?
Why did the Washer Fluid Level Light come on in your Skoda Kamiq? The honest answer is 'it depends', but the possibilities cluster into a recognisable set of causes. Knowing them in advance means you will not be caught off guard by a diagnosis, and it lets you sanity-check any repair quote against what commonly goes wrong on the Skoda Kamiq.
- Low washer fluid (normal)
- Faulty reservoir level sensor
- Disconnected sensor wiring
- Debris around the float
How to Fix the Washer Fluid Level Light on a Skoda Kamiq
To resolve the Washer Fluid Level Light on your Skoda Kamiq, resist the urge to simply disconnect the battery and hope it stays off. A warning that is cleared without addressing the cause almost always returns. The step-by-step approach below is the same logical order a professional follows on the Skoda Kamiq: confirm the basics, read the stored codes, then target the actual fault.
- Top up the washer reservoir with screen wash
- Run the washers to confirm operation
- If still lit, inspect the level sensor and connector
- Clean debris from around the float
- Replace the sensor if it reads incorrectly

Professional Mechanic Tips
Use a proper screen-wash mix in a Skoda Kamiq, not plain water — water freezes in winter and grows algae that blocks the jets.
